Aller au contenu principal

changePassword

Changement de mot de passe de l'utilisateur (uniquement pour les tarifs de compte activés avec la fonctionnalité d'activation activée).

Description

Cette méthode change le mot de passe d'un utilisateur autorisé. Si elle réussit, elle renverra true. Elle retourne une promesse qui se résout en une valeur booléenne.

AuthProvider.changePassword(

marker*, userIdentifier*, type*, code*, newPassword*, repeatPassword

);

Parameters schema

Schema

marker:* string
L'identifiant textuel du fournisseur d'autorisation.
exemple : email

userIdentifier:* string
L'identifiant textuel de l'objet utilisateur (connexion utilisateur)
exemple : example@oneentry.cloud

type:* string
Type d'opération (1 - pour changer le mot de passe, 2 - pour la récupération)
exemple : 1

code:* string
Code de service
exemple : EW32RF

newPassword:* string
Nouveau mot de passe
exemple : 654321

repeatPassword: string
Variable optionnelle contenant le nouveau mot de passe répété pour validation
exemple : 654321

Examples

Minimal example

const response = await AuthProvider.changePassword(
'email',
'example@oneentry.cloud',
1,
'EW32RF',
654321,
654321
);

Example response

true